While the task force recommended the school keep its Dutchman name and colors, orange and blue, it suggested changing the image of the mascot because of its potential representation of Peter Stuyvesant, the last Dutch governor of New Amsterdam, who had a peg leg like the mascot. Collegiate had already opted to scratch the A.D. notation as part of its 1628 founding date on its seal, arguing that Anno Domini, Latin for in the year of our Lord,was inappropriate for what is now a secular institution. Included in the school's seal are two mottos: Eendracht Maakt Macht, Dutch for "In unity there is strength", and Nisi Dominus Frustra, Latin for "unless God, then in vain."
